Why INTERNSMART® for Students?
The demand for internships is rising as increasing numbers of young people are wanting to "get a leg up" on their future. The following are a list of reasons why INTERNSMART® is smart for youth:
- Service learning and career education starts in elementary school.
- Internship experiences begin in junior high. Internships are required in many high schools and post secondary schools for graduation.
- Students see internships as an effective way to move into the job market and/or enhance a college application.
- Students need help finding internships that "fit" their skills, interests.
- Students find themselves in an internship doing work that is far below their expectations or skill levels. "I filed papers all day."
- Students need effective supervisors and mentors as a key component of the experience.
- Students are expected to graduate from high school or college prepared to enter the workforce but know little about the world of work.
